Accelerating Pharmaceutical Innovation Through AI Integration
The integration of artificial intelligence across diverse areas of the pharmaceutical sector, including drug discovery and development, drug repurposing, and clinical trials, is fundamental to economic growth. AI improves processes, reducing human labor and accelerating processing times, making drug development faster and more efficient. AI also improves drug manufacturing by improving the quality of drug formulations and ensuring the consistency of manufactured products. This change facilitates rapid decision-making and improves the combination of drugs into appropriate forms, resulting in better products. The tremendous impact of AI on life sciences makes it a major driver of innovation and efficiency in AI in life science analytics market.


AI for Future Healthcare Innovations
The integration of artificial intelligence into healthcare represents a significant opportunity for growth in the life sciences analytics market. As machine learning supports the development of precision medicine, it addresses the urgent need for advanced diagnostic and treatment recommendations, overcoming initial challenges in this area. Rapid advances in AI-enabled imaging research suggest that most radiographs and pathology images will soon be analyzed by machines, increasing their accuracy and working well. In addition, the increasing use of voice and text authentication for patient communication and clinical data collection further illustrates the evolution of AI in healthcare. This change promises to not only improve patient outcomes but also make AI essential for innovation and expansion in the AI in life science analytics market.

 

Data Privacy Challenges
Data privacy poses serious limitations to the growth of AI in life science analytics market. Ensuring that AI systems are reliable and trustworthy is critical in the managed care industry. This need goes beyond initial recognition; it requires ongoing operational monitoring to maintain compliance and minimize risk. These challenges can hinder the integration of AI because organizations must navigate a complex regulatory environment while maintaining data integrity and ethical standards, ultimately impacting the adoption and use of AI technology in the life sciences.

Recent News in the AI in Life Science Analytics Market

•    In May 2024, Elsevier, a global leader in information and analytics, announced the launch of SciBite Chat, a new AI-powered tool built atop SciBite Search, SciBite’s award-winning platform. 


•    In February 2024, QIAGEN announced the launch of QIAGEN Biomedical KB-AI, a new generative AI-driven knowledge base designed to propel drug discovery in the pharma and biotech industries. This new offering is designed for data scientists and bioinformaticians who are looking for the most comprehensive knowledge graphs to fuel data-driven drug discovery. 


•    In June 2024, EPAM Systems, Inc. announced it acquired Odysseus Data Services, Inc., a top health data analytics company. Odysseus will expand EPAM’s ability to transform the life sciences value chain through advanced data analytics, data methods, and artificial intelligence (AI). 


•    In May 2024, Sanofi, Formation Bio, and OpenAI collaborated to build AI-powered software to accelerate drug development and bring new medicines to patients more efficiently. The three teams were bringing together data, software, and tuning models to develop custom, purpose-built solutions across the drug development lifecycle.
